## 4.2.0 — Changed defaults

Slimtide now strips debug symbols and locale data by default; opt out per layer if needed. Base image switched to the minimal Ferrox runtime, cutting median image size 38%. Multi-stage cache pruning is on by default and removes intermediate layers older than 72h. Reviewers: flag any Dockerfile still pinning the fat base. The new default build configuration shipping with this release is shown below.

config for kafof-bawef:
holath:
  log_level: debug
  metrics_host: metrics.holath.qorvelsys.internal
  pin: 2191
  pool_size: 32

Subject: Thumbnail queue cut-over done

Team — the Pexleaf thumbnail queue moved off the legacy broker last night. Old consumers drained, no loss, backlog cleared by 03:10. Retries now dead-letter after five attempts instead of looping. Legacy broker stays read-only for two weeks, then gets decommissioned. For future reference, the new queue runs with the following settings.

settings of fafog-haduf:
ZORIX_PIN=4648
ZORIX_METRICS_HOST=metrics.zorix.paliqsys.corp
ZORIX_LOG_LEVEL=info
ZORIX_TENANT=druix

## Tuning

The Fenwick Renderfarm transcoder pool enforces strict per-job isolation, so every tuning value below has a security implication: larger queue depths increase the window during which unverified input sits in shared memory, and longer worker lifetimes extend the blast radius of a compromised codec process. Please review each change against the threat model in the Halverton audit notes. The current production constants are listed here.

tuning constants:
BUDGETS = {
    "druath": 240,
    "lamwyn": 180,
    "silael": 275,
}

Subject: ORM refactor handover

Taking over the Larkspan ORM refactor from me as of Friday. Security notes: legacy layer still builds raw SQL in two modules; both are flagged for parameterization this sprint. Audit logging is already on the new adapter. For your review, the staging database is reachable with the connection string below.

replica DSN, kajep-yahag: mssql://praok_svc:iF@db-8d68.plorvaio.local:5432/eliion